Ecosystems like Node use package managers such as npm to manage modules and their dependencies. The package manager ensures that each module is separated from other modules and their dependencies. As a result, while a complex application might include the same module multiple times with several different versions in different parts of the module graph, users do not need to think about this complexity.
> [!NOTE] > You can also achieve version management using relative paths, but this is subpar because, among other things, this forces a particular structure on your project, and prevents you from using bare module names.
Import maps similarly allow you to have multiple versions of dependencies in your application and refer to them using the same module specifier. You implement this with the scopes key, which allows you to provide module specifier maps that will be used depending on the path of the script performing the import. With this mapping, if a script with a URL that contains /node_modules/dependency/ imports cool-module, the version in /node_modules/some/other/location/cool-module/index.js will be used. The map in imports is used as a fallback if there is no matching scope in the scoped map, or the matching scopes don't contain a matching specifier. For example, if cool-module is imported from a script with a non-matching scope path, then the module specifier map in imports will be used instead, mapping to the version in /node_modules/cool-module/index.js.
Note that the path used to select a scope does not affect how the address is resolved. The value in the mapped path does not have to match the scopes path, and relative paths are still resolved to the base URL of the script that contains the import map.
Just as for module specifier maps, you can have many scope keys, and these may contain overlapping paths. If multiple scopes match the referrer URL, then the most specific scope path is checked first (the longest scope key) for a matching specifier. The browsers will fall back to the next most specific matching scoped path if there is no matching specifier, and so on. If there is no matching specifier in any of the matching scopes, the browser checks for a match in the module specifier map in the imports key.
